We are Makers of Tomorrow.We use our technical expertise to build thriving businesses for our clients.By learning through experience, we know what really matters, and we apply our skills and creative use of technology to every client and situation in order to create truly unique solutions for the future
We love the magic that happens when we are able to combine our experience with our curiosity for the future, and create new, great solutions that makes us and our clients better, faster, smarter and more fun.
Who we’re looking for
We are looking for a Senior Developer with a passion for technology and the willingness to develop state-of-the-art web applications.
We see technology as an enabler, tools to make life easier for people.
You’re a forward thinking and curious developer that has worked on projects directly deploying products and services to users.
You’re confident in taking roles in both the front and back-end and you quickly pick up on navigating other fields where you lack experience and deploy your new knowledge with confidence.
Strong Web development skills, including:
– Fluency in English
– 4+ years experience
– Design of the overall architecture of the web application
– Implementation of services and APIs to power web applications
– Building reusable code and libraries for future use
– Optimization of applications for speed and scalability
– Integration of the front-end and back-end aspects of the web applications
– A good sense of usability and attention to detail
– Git version control
– Strong knowledge & Experience with the Agile work processes
– Strong knowledge of web architecture and distributed systems
– Strong knowledge of application architecture and design patterns
– Strong knowledge of concurrent programming and thread handling
– Good understanding of ReactJS, or similar working frameworks
– Good understanding of automated testing platforms and unit tests, such as Jest and Mocha
– Good understanding of Spring Framework
– Understanding how to work with responsive and mobile first design
– Experience with code versioning tools such as Git
– Experience with NoSQL databases
– Experience with Agile work processes
– Fluency in English, both written and spoken, and good communication skills
– Building and distributing tools like Jenkins or Maven
– GUI ( design and testing )
– Cloud solutions and virtualization
– Integration technologies like JMS/MQ, Web services, ReST, AMQP, MQT
Typical technology stacks that we work with:
• NodeJS
• Kubernetes
• Google Appengine
• HTML5,CSS3/SaSS and frameworks like bootstrap
• JavaScript/TypeScript and JSON
• Frameworks like React,and Angular Js
• Frameworks like Node.js-Express, .NET Core, Python-Django, Java/JEE, Symfony/PHP
• MySQL/SQL, postgres and mongodb Databases
• Cloud platforms like Firebase, AWS, Azure
• DevOps and deployment – iOS/Android, Heroku
Send your CV for consideration to :
Pour postuler, envoyez votre CV et votre lettre de motivation par e-mail à contact@wappdev.com